How to Scad Student Login
To login to your SCAD student account, follow these steps:
1. Visit the official SCAD website at www.scad.edu.
2. Click on the “MySCAD” link located at the top right corner of the page.
3. Next, click on the “Student Login” option provided on the page.
4. Enter your SCAD email address in the ‘Username’ field.
5. Type in your password in the ‘Password’ field.
6. Click on the “Login” button.
You should now have successfully logged into your SCAD student account.
What to do if I forgot my Password or Username?
If you have forgotten your password or username, you can retrieve them easily by following these steps:
1. Go to the SCAD Student Login page.
2. Click on the “Forgot Password” or “Forgot Username” link depending on which details you have forgotten.
3. For the “Forgot Password” option, enter your email address associated with your SCAD account and click on the “Submit” button.
4. SCAD will send you an email containing a link to reset your password.
5. For the “Forgot Username” option, enter your first name, last name, and birthdate and click on “Submit”.
6. Your username will be sent to the email address associated with your SCAD account.
If you have any further queries, you can contact the SCAD IT help desk for assistance.
